Posting Date: 15/09/2015 Company: McGills Buses Ltd Location: UK-Scotland-Renfrew Industries: Travel, transportation and tourism Job type: Full timeMcGills Buses Ltd Trainee commercial assistant Job description Trainee Commercial Assistant - McGill's Buses - vacancy at Greenock Head Office McGill’s is Scotland’s largest privately-owned bus company, operating over 350 buses on more than 100 routes throughout Glasgow, Renfrewshire, Inverclyde and North Lanarkshire. An exciting opportunity has arisen within our commercial team for a Trainee Scheduler. The vacancy is based at our Head Office, 99 Eanhill Road, Greenock and the successful candidate will report directly to the Commercial Manager, the successful candidate will receive full training in the development of robust and cost-effective route planning schedules and driver duty schedules. You will also be exposed to analysis work around bus route performance from an operational and financial perspective. Applicants should be highly numerate, computer literate and organised, showing a high attention to detail. You will also need to be competent in the use of Microsoft packages, particularly Word, Excel and Outlook. The role also requires you to have exc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, together with an ability to build positive working relationships within and outside McGill’s buses. We’d expect you to be educated to a Higher/HNC/HND level and have a good awareness of local geography and an understanding of local bus service operations. The successful candidate will be a motivated team player, who can work effectively in using their initiative to solve problems. A full car driving licence would be an advantage, but not an essential. In return, McGill’s offers full training with excellent prospects for progression, a competitive salary, contributory pension scheme and free travel.
